I asked John over at LAGP if I could share the info from the email and he said go ahead, so I thought some of you might like hearing what he has going:
From John:
"Our player/partner/owner, Bryson DeChambeau, has been using a new shaft he helped design in his driver, 3 and 5 wood since shortly after the Masters. Still tweaking things a bit for him, but should have it dialed very soon. His shaft is a low launch, low spin profile, specifically designed for stability and shot repeatability. Very stout in the mid-section and tip, and a bit softer in the hands to provide some feel. (low launch, low spin, extremely stable feel)
Another prototype we’ve testing has been put in play by Jason Dufner. Since putting this shaft in play, his driving distance and accuracy have increased tremendously. He lead the field in driving accuracy at the Memorial and was 3rd in accuracy at the US Open, hitting 82% of the fairways in a tight Open setup. This new shaft, code named OLYSS (OLY Signature Series, ‘Oly’ is my industry nickname), is a mid/low launch, low spin product. It has a straight taper profile from the very butt end down to the tip, to provide exceptional feel. (mid launch, low spin, softer feel)
Also working on a parallel butt profile, low launch/low-mid spin offering (think Tensei and Hzrdus), that has been testing very very well. A bit crisper feeling in the hands with outstanding control and launch. (mid/low launch, low spin, crisp/solid feel)"

Another update from John at LAGP regarding his proto shafts and how they are performing on tour:
"Roberto Diaz put an OLYSS 65 Tour X in play last week at the Travelers. He finished tied for 8th for his first top ten ever (in a full field event – had a T10 in Puerto Rico last fall). He hit 84% of the fairways in the event. His average going into the week was 66%."
